The role of a light keeper is one that has fascinated many throughout history. A light keeper is a person responsible for maintaining a lighthouse, ensuring that the light remains operational to guide ships safely through treacherous waters. This profession, though less common today due to advancements in technology, played a crucial role in maritime safety for centuries. The life of a light keeper was often solitary and demanding, requiring not only technical skills but also a deep sense of responsibility and dedication. In the past, a light keeper would typically live on-site with their family, tending to the lighthouse day and night. They would have to climb the tower regularly to clean the lens and ensure that the light could be seen from miles away. The job involved a great deal of maintenance work, including repairing the machinery that powered the light and keeping the surrounding area clear of obstacles that could obstruct the beam. One of the most significant aspects of being a light keeper was the isolation. Many lighthouses were located on remote islands or rugged coastlines, far from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. This solitude could be both a blessing and a curse. While it allowed for peaceful contemplation and a connection with nature, it also meant limited social interaction and the challenges of living in harsh weather conditions. Despite these challenges, the legacy of the light keeper endures. Stories of their bravery and commitment to safety have been immortalized in literature and film. For instance, many novels depict the life of a light keeper, showcasing their struggles and triumphs. These narratives often highlight the strong bond between the keeper and the sea, illustrating how their work was not just a job but a calling. In modern times, most lighthouses are automated, reducing the need for a human light keeper. However, the romantic image of the solitary figure tending to the light continues to capture our imagination. Today, many former lighthouses have been converted into museums or vacation rentals, allowing people to experience the allure of being a light keeper without the responsibilities that came with the job.
